38 CFR 62.32 – Supportive service: Assistance in obtaining VA benefits

(a) Grantees must assist participants in obtaining any benefits from VA for which the participants are eligible. Such benefits include, but are not limited to:
(1) Vocational and rehabilitation counseling;
(2) Employment and training service;
(3) Educational assistance; and
(4) Health care services.
(b) Grantees are not permitted to represent participants before VA with respect to a claim for VA benefits unless they are recognized for that purpose pursuant to 38 U.S.C. § 5902. Employees and members of grantees are not permitted to provide such representation unless the individual providing representation is accredited pursuant to 38 U.S.C. chapter 59.
